Legal Name Change

Changing your name in court does not automatically change the name on your birth record. That process can only be done through the Changes Unit here in the State Vital Records office. You will need to submit a completed and signed application, a fee of $40.00 in the form of a personal check or money order made payable to the State of Michigan, a copy of your current, valid photo identification and a copy of the court order for documentation. The $40.00 fee includes one certified copy of the record with the changes made. Additional copies are $12.00 each if ordered at the same time.
